Meet mazda’s new CX-5

- BY IAIN CURRY

Mazda’s CX-5 is Australia's SUV superstar.

As a nation, we've bought more of these mid-size high-riding five-seaters than any other SUV in each of the past four years.

A new generation CX-5 has just been launched with fresher styling, improved specificat­ion and safety, a quieter and more refined cabin and more assured handling.

Prices remain steady, with the range starting at an appealing $28,690 for the entry-level Maxx model, and a choice of four other grades — Maxx Sport, Touring, GT and Akera. Body styling is sharper while retaining the familiar CX-5 style. There are more soft touch materials inside replacing hard plastics, and cabin noise has been greatly reduced when driving.

From entry-level you score extras such as a seven-inch touchscree­n, reclining rear seats, push button start and added standard safety of blind spot monitoring, reverse camera and smart city brake support.

Specificat­ion improvemen­ts and a more powerful 2.5-litre engine arrives as you climb the range, with the range-topping GT and Akera models feeling genuinely premium with their leather cabins, power heated seats and 19-inch wheels.

Another bonus is boot space, which has been improved by 40-litres over the old CX-5.
